The annual Christmas Party was held by Horning Bridge Club on Monday 9th December 2019. Robert and Diane Harber greeted arriving members with a festive drink, which they enjoyed whilst awaiting start of play. A mid-session interval was taken where all sampled a fantastic selection of savouries and sweets that members had provided for the occasion.
A fun bridge pivot movement was played and at the end of play scores were totted up resulting in individual North, South, East and West winners. An additional prize was also presented to the winner of "Trick with a 2". Prizes were presented by Chairperson Ann Riley.
Chairperson Ann Riley also presented Cathy and David Smith with a gift of thanks for their continuing work behind the scenes to maintain the successful running of the Club.
North Winner: Mike Williams (2,700)
South Winner: Giles Jackson (4,700))
East Winner: Teresa Hales (390)
West Winner: Margaret Whipp (2,190)
Trick with a 2 Winner: Jenny Hemmings

This years' A.G.M. was held on the 9th September 2019.
Chairman Ron Hunt announced that he was stepping down as Chairman after completing his second stint since the formation of the Club in 2000. Ron was pleased to announce that Ann Riley had put herself forward for election as Chairperson, which was duly proposed, seconded and accepted by the attending members.
Jenny Hemmings also announced that she was stepping down as Partner Finder, although she expressed her desire to stay on as a Committee member. Ron was pleased to announce that Sue Howes had agreed to be nominated in Jenny's old role, which was duly proposed, seconded and accepted by the members.
The remaining existing Officers of the Club and Committee members also agreed to stand for re-election ,which was duly proposed, seconded and accepted by the members. The Club welcomes all newly elected and re-elected Committee members.
The newly elected Committee now comprises: Ann Riley (Chairperson), Laurie Platt (Vice Chairman), Peter Bowman (Treasurer), Glenny McAndie (Secretary), Cynthia Dennes (Catering), Sue Howes (Partner Finder) and General Committee members Jenny Hemmings, Jenny Pearce and Jim Fletcher.
The outgoing Chairman thanked all Committee members for their support throughout the year and wished the new Chairperson best wished for the forthcoming year. Directors and scorers Robert Harber, Peter Bowman, David Smith, Jim Fletcher and Ann Riley were also thanked for their continuing support throughout the year.
Trophies were presented by Ron Hunt to the following:
2019 Bill Broughton Shield Winners: David Smith & Giles Jackson
2018/19 Founders Trophy Winners: Pat Whittle & Peter Bowman

Horning BC Committee arranged another Summer Away Day for Monday, 24th June 2019 at The Old Rectory Hotel, Crostwick. A big vote of thanks to Laurie Platt, Jenny Hemmings and Ron Hunt who carried out the majority of the organisation required. Also, thank you to Brian Cunningham who transported all the bridge equipment to and from the Hotel.
The days events were held in the Hotel's spacious conservatory restaurant where, on arrival, members and guests were served tea or coffee and settled into the bridge tables to await start of play.
Chairman Ron Hunt outlined the approximate timetable for the day and bridge commenced at 10:15 am. Normal duplicate bridge was played, but having separate N-S and E-W winners to allow for separate winners on the day.
Bridge was adjourned at 12:30 pm whereupon the Hotel staff provided a delicious hot and cold buffet luncheon. As the weather was set fair, most of the members and guests gathered outside on the garden patio to enjoy a lunchtime drink with their buffet. The staff were excellent in providing a continuous stream of food to replace diminished plates!
Bridge re-commenced at 1:45 pm until approximately 3:15 pm when tea and coffee was available whilst the prize winners were announced and presented by Ron Hunt.
NORTH-SOUTH WINNERS: Lynne Bruce & Mike Williams
EAST-WEST WINNERS: John Love & Steve Beckley

BRIDGE AWAY DAY AT STOWER GRANGE 14th JANUARY 2019 |
Once again Horning Bridge Club held its annual winter bridge away-day at the Stower Grange Hotel on Monday 14th January 2019.
On arrival at 09:45 members and guests enjoyed tea or coffee in the bar and lounge before settling into the bridge tables to await start of play. Chairman Ron Hunt outlined the approximate timetable for the day and bridge commenced at 10:30. Normal duplicate bridge was played, but having separate N-S and E-W winners to allow for separate winners on the day.
Bridge was adjourned at 12:00 for members and guests to gather in the bar and lounge to partake in a lunchtime drink prior to a delicious two-course lunch provided by the Hotel.
Bridge re-commenced at 2:15 until approximately 3:30 when a special raffle was held in aid of the Childline Charity. A fantastic collection of £290.00 was raised for this well-deserving charity.
President Suzanne Gill and Chairman Ron Hunt presented the raffle prizes to the lucky winners.
Following the end of the bridge session, N-S and E-W prize winners were announced and President Suzanne Gill presented the prizes to the winners.
NORTH-SOUTH WINNERS: Jill Abbott and Hazel Carney
EAST-WEST WINNERS: John Court and Laurie Platt
A big thank-you to the Horning Bridge Club Committee who organised a great day out, Brian Cunningham who helped to transport and set up the bridge equipmet and to the Tournament Director of the day, Robert Harber.
